Counting Cards In Blackjack
If you are a devotee of 21 then you must be apprised of the reality that in vingt-et-un some actions of your prior play usually will have an affect your up-and-coming play. It is not like any other gambling den games like roulette or craps in which there is little effect of the preceding action on the unfolding one. In twenty-one if a player has additional cards of large proportion of course it’s constructive for the gambler in up-coming matches and if the player has detrimental cards, it negatively acts on their up-and-coming hands. In most of the instances it’s extremely hard for the gambler to remember the cards which have been played in the previous matches notably in the multiple deck dealing shoe. Each and every left over card in the pack gets some positive, negative or zero point value for counting cards.
As a rule it’s seen that cards with smaller value for instance 2, 3 have positive value and the larger cards provide a a negative value. The different value is attached for each card dependent on the counting cards technique. Although it’s better to make a count on card counter’s personal best guess with respect to cards dealt and cards not yet dealt however occasionally the counter can likely make a tally of the point values in her mind. This is likely to assist you to figure out the absolute proportion or total of cards which are remaining in the deck. You want to know that the bigger the card values the harder the card counting activity is. Multiple-level count intensifies the adversity while the counting process that is comprised of lower value such as 1, -1, 0 referred to as level one count is the easiest.
Once it comes to receiving 21 then the importance of aces is above all other cards. Consequently dealing with aces is very critical in the attempt of card counting in vingt-et-un.
The gambler will be able to make larger bets if the pack of cards is in their favor and lesser bets when the deck is not. The gambler can change their selections according to the cards and gamble with a secure course of action. If the process of card counting is extremely genuine and precise the affect on the game will be positive, this is why the gambling dens employ preventive actions to stop card counting.
